A Continued-Fraction Representation of the Time-Correlation Functions

TL;DR: In this paper, a continued fraction expansion of the Laplace transform of the time correlation functions is obtained, which enables us to express the generalized susceptibilities and the transport coefficients in terms of the static correlation functions of a set of quantities.

Theory of Dynamical Behaviors of Ferromagnetic Spins

TL;DR: In this paper, a macroscopic equation determining the change in time of an inhomogeneous magnetization is derived with explicit expressions for the frequency spectrum and damping constant of spin waves.

Collective Motion of Particles at Finite Temperatures

TL;DR: In this article, a quantum-statistical theory of frequency spectra and damping constants of interacting particles at finite temperatures is presented, and molecular expressions for the intensities and widths of the spectral lines are written in terms of generalized transport coefficients which depend upon the wavelength of the collective oscillation or frequency spectrum.
